The actor, who plays Lord Shiva in the play, appreciates the latter’s immersive approach to playing Lord Ram, thus adding to the growing buzz around Nitesh Tiwari’s ambitious epic.

As anticipation builds around Ramayana, new insights into Ranbir Kapoor’s preparation for the role of Lord Ram continue to surface. Actor Tarun Khanna recently shared how Kapoor went beyond conventional methods, attending live stage performances of the epic to better understand its emotional and cultural depth.

Speaking about the experience, Khanna revealed, “At Mumbai’s NCPA, Ranbir Kapoor, his wife Alia Bhatt, his mother Neetu Singh, and their friend Ayan Mukerji all four of them came to watch our play (Humare Ram). Just for Ranbir’s preparation. Think about how seriously Ranbir Kapoor takes his craft that he went to watch a theatre performance just to understand Ramayan; to see what makes it so powerful.”

Kapoor’s approach highlights a more immersive process as he steps into one of Indian mythology’s most revered characters. Ever since his first look as Lord Ram was unveiled, the film has generated significant interest, with audiences noting both his physical transformation and the effort to embody the character’s essence.

Directed by Nitesh Tiwari, Ramayana is envisioned as a large-scale cinematic retelling of the ancient epic. The project will be released in two parts and is being positioned as a global spectacle, combining extensive visual effects with a star-driven ensemble.

Joining Kapoor is Sai Pallavi as Sita, while Yash takes on the role of Ravana. The cast also includes Sunny Deol as Hanuman and Ravi Dubey as Lakshman, bringing together a mix of actors from across industries.

The film is backed by Namit Malhotra’s Prime Focus Studios, in association with the eight-time Oscar-winning VFX company DNEG and Yash’s Monster Mind Creations. With a strong emphasis on scale and visual storytelling, the makers are aiming to deliver a version of Ramayana that resonates with both domestic and international audiences.

Planned as a two-part release, the first instalment is slated to hit theatres during Diwali 2026, followed by the second part in Diwali 2027. With production underway and details gradually emerging, the film continues to remain one of the most closely watched projects in the Indian film industry.
